在链上资产流转的实际应用中,“转账打包”往往决定了体验的上限:打包效率越高,交易确认越快;打包策略越智能,成本越可控;观测与运维越专业,系统越稳定。以TPWallet为例,从高效支付处理、智能化数字化转型、专业观测、全球化创新科技、弹性云计算系统到代币场景,可以形成一条清晰的技术与业务链路:既能提升吞吐与成功率,也能让多种代币与多元场景无缝对接。
一、高效支付处理:把“等待”变成“可预测”
转账打包本质上是对交易请求的聚合与调度。对用户而言,关心的是两件事:速度与确定性。对系统而言,关心的是吞吐、手续费、链上拥堵下的成功率。
1)聚合策略优化
将多个小额转账进行打包聚合,可以减少链上交易数量,降低整体手续费与签名/广播开销。常见策略包括按时间窗口聚合(例如在某个毫秒级/秒级窗口内收集交易)、按区块或高度触发聚合,以及按金额/优先级分层聚合。
2)优先级与费用管理
在拥堵时期,如果所有交易一视同仁,成功率与确认时间会波动。高效支付处理会引入优先级队列:例如支付类交易优先、低优先级批量延迟;同时根据网络状态动态调整费用参数(如gas/手续费估计),让“打包”在成本与速度之间达到平衡。
3)去重与幂等控制
打包链路中不可避免会出现重试、网络抖动、重复提交。通过幂等标识(如交易意图ID、nonce管理、签名摘要校验)实现去重,避免同一笔意图在打包时重复执行,从而提升整体稳定性。
二、智能化数字化转型:让打包“会学”
从传统工程到智能化数字化转型,关键不在于增加更多计算,而在于把“经验”变成“策略”。
1)基于数据的打包决策
收集并分析链上拥堵、历史确认时延、不同代币的平均成功率、手续费波动等数据,为打包器提供决策输入。例如当观测到某类型交易在特定时间段更易确认,可以在队列策略中增加该类交易权重。
2)自动化路由与风控
在多链或多网络环境里,智能路由可根据RPC延迟、链上状态、失败原因自动选择更优通道。风控模块对异常请求进行识别:例如明显不合理的转账参数、重复请求风暴、疑似诈骗地址等,防止打包资源被滥用。
3)智能化运营与成本优化
数字化转型还体现在可视化运营:通过实时看板与策略回放,运维与产品能快速定位“为何某一段时间确认变慢”,并调整阈值、窗口大小与费用策略。
三、专业观测:用可观测性守住可靠性
“打包”不是一次性操作,而是一条链路:从用户发起到链上确认,中间包含签名、打包、广播、重试、回执解析等环节。要让系统可靠,必须把关键指标观测清楚。
1)核心指标体系
建议围绕以下维度建立指标:
- 打包吞吐:单位时间成功打包数/交易数
- 成功率:打包成功与链上成功的比率
- 时延:从入队到打包、从打包到确认的分段耗时
- 失败原因分布:如手续费不足、nonce冲突、链上拒绝、超时
- 资源消耗:CPU/内存、签名吞吐、网络带宽、队列长度
2)链上与链下联动观测
专业观测强调“端到端”。例如将链下队列状态与链上回执高度对应,形成“时间线”,方便快速定位瓶颈。
3)告警与自动处置

仅有仪表盘不足,需要自动告警与处置机制:当成功率低于阈值、队列持续膨胀或回执超时增大时,系统能自动切换备用RPC、调整费用策略或降低批量窗口。
四、全球化创新科技:面向多地区的稳定体验
全球化意味着跨网络环境、跨延迟区域、跨链路部署。创新科技体现在如何让TPWallet在不同地理位置下仍保持一致体验。
1)就近接入与多Region部署
通过多地域部署与就近路由,减少用户到服务端的延迟;同时支持区域级故障切换,避免单点故障导致服务不可用。
2)跨时区的策略调度
不同地区用户活跃时间不同。打包系统可结合地区流量模型动态调整队列阈值与聚合窗口,提升在“高峰时段”的稳定性与确认速度。

3)合规与地址/资产适配
全球化场景通常涉及监管与合规要求。系统需要支持更完善的地址校验、风险标记与用户资产适配策略,确保不同地区的合规策略能与转账打包流程衔接。
五、弹性云计算系统:在波动中保持韧性
支付与转账请求天然有峰谷,弹性云计算系统确保在需求变化时仍能稳定运行。
1)自动扩缩容(Auto Scaling)
打包器与签名服务可以按队列长度、CPU使用率、RPC延迟等指标自动扩缩容。当流量暴增,系统扩容以保持吞吐;当负载下降,自动回落以控制成本。
2)弹性队列与回压(Backpressure)
为防止下游故障导致上游无限堆积,引入回压机制:例如限制最大队列长度、对低优先级请求进行延迟或降级策略,保障关键交易优先完成。
3)容灾与灰度发布
关键组件支持多可用区冗余与快速恢复。发布策略采用灰度与回滚:即便打包策略更新,也能在小流量验证后逐步扩大范围,降低风险。
六、代币场景:从单一资产到多样化生态
代币场景是转账打包的“真实舞台”。不同代币在链上规则、费用估算、合约交互成本方面可能不同,因此打包策略必须具备灵活性。
1)同链多代币的分层处理
同一网络中可能同时存在主币与各类代币。系统可以按代币类型分层队列:对合约交互成本更高或失败原因更复杂的代币设置更保守的参数与更细粒度的重试策略。
2)跨链与桥接场景
在跨链转账中,打包不仅需要完成本链交易,还要与跨链确认、汇总签名或桥接状态机联动。专业实现会把跨链状态纳入观测与重试逻辑,避免“本链打包成功但跨链失败”的体验落差。
3)批量分发与场景化业务
代币场景常见包括空投、分红、游戏内支付、商户结算、会员发放等。打包聚合能显著降低手续费与链上交易数量;智能化策略还可按收款地址质量与历史成功率进行分组,提高总体成功率。
结语:端到端能力塑造“可用、好用、值得用”
TPWallet转账打包的价值并不止于“把交易打到一起”。真正的竞争力来自端到端能力:以高效支付处理提升速度与成功率;用智能化数字化转型把经验转成策略;通过专业观测降低故障定位成本;依托全球化创新科技实现一致体验;借助弹性云计算系统承受波动;最终落在多代币场景上,形成可持续的生态服务能力。把这些维度打通,才能让链上转账从“偶尔可用”走向“长期可靠”。
评论
MiraChen
打包策略如果能把拥堵与优先级动态结合,体验会稳定很多,尤其是高峰期。
NeoKaito
文里对观测指标和告警处置讲得很到位,端到端时间线能显著缩短排障。
云端小舟
弹性扩缩容+回压机制的思路很实用,能避免队列无限堆积导致连锁故障。
SoraWang
代币分层处理让我想到不同合约交互成本差异,确实应该单独队列或策略。
LunaViolet
跨地区就近接入和多Region容灾,对于全球用户的确认时延很关键。